CMT is seeking an Art Director, Off Air Design to join their team in Nashville, TN.

The Art Director leads the visual process of creating compelling concepts from discovery to detailed design, delivering consistent work across all platforms. They are responsible for setting the visual tone for their projects, including design concepts, typography, photography and content ideation (when applicable). The Art Director will lead and inspire a team of designers. They will cultivate and manage close partnerships with internal and external clients. The Art Director will understand the CMT Brand and the channel's programming direction, and will help translate that into off air designs that drive interest and viewership to the channel. The Art Director is a detailed driven, creative thinker and doer who can develop and guide strategic design campaigns. They also have an understanding of budget constraints and can work successfully within those parameters. In addition, the Art Director will communicate effectively and comfortably to senior leadership, clients and to their subordinate staff.

Responsibilities:
Develop strategic branding efforts and direct all Off-Air Design (print and digital) projects, including consumer and trade campaigns, marketing materials, packaging for consumer products, merchandise, collateral, programming event materials and more.

Oversee the design work of print and digital designers on various projects, and collaborate with the network’s VPs and Directors to maintain a level of excellence that enhances every part of CMT business and brand.

Work closely with On Air Design Art Director in developing and executing design and animation that reflects CMT brand with an attention to consistency and collaboration across platforms.

Supervise the in-house design team on specific projects; give design criticisms and direction to senior and junior levels.

Select and supervise outside design and advertising agencies when needed to execute and produce creative campaigns.

Work with department managers to assign, schedule, budget and direct all assignments.

Seek out creative new hires into the department as well as discovering new external resources.

Contribute to senior level strategy decisions relating to trade and consumer advertising.

Supervise the evolution of CMT brand.

Direct photo shoots and work with outside art buyers and production companies as needed.

Present work to network executives, advertising managers, programmers and producers, and revise work to achieve mutually agreed-upon network communications goals.

Provide strong leadership and serve as an example of CMT Creative philosophies by providing inspiration, motivation, guidance, training and management.

Pursue innovative and experimental design techniques.

Collaborate with technical managers and departments to build artist workstations and upgrade technology when necessary.

Must have working knowledge of media buys, traffic and production specifications.

Channel Summary:
CMT is the leading television and digital authority on country music and entertainment, reaching more than 92 million homes in the U.S. CMT and its website, CMT.com, offer

an unparalleled mix of music, news, live concerts and series and is the top resource for country music on demand. The network’s digital platforms include the 24-hour music channel, CMT Pure Country, CMT Mobile and CMT VOD.
